Penfold's Bin60A Coonawarra Cabernet Barossa Shiraz 2004
|
|

Exquisite parcels of Block 20 Coonawarra cabernet sauvignon, Koonunga Hill and Kalimna Vineyard Barossa shiraz were identified and separately vinified at Magill and Nuriootpa in open and closed headed down fermenters. Towards dryness, the wine was racked into 100% new oak where the wine completed fermentation. After malolactic fermentation individual components were classified and then selected for inclusion into the 2004 Penfolds Bin 60a blend.
Deep in colour, this youthful elemental wine shows a miraculous overlapping of aromas and flavours. The regional characters of both Coonawarra and the Barossa Valley are finely poised. The highly perfumed chamomile/violet/mocha aromas, immense concentration, savoury flavours and classically structured palate are in superb balance. This beautifully refined cross-regional/varietal with its meaty nuances and fine-grained tannins will continue to evolve in the cellar for decades.

Mountadam Barossa Cabernet Merlot 2004
|
|
Mountadam Barossa Cabernet Merlot is a blend of the classic Bordeaux varieties. Fruit is sourced from both High Eden and the Barossa floor. This combination produces wines that have the elegance of the cooler Eden Valley and the richness of the traditional Barossa Valley wines. The relatively small quantity we make is an opportunity for us to hand craft a unique blend of Barossa Cabernet Sauvignon and Merlot.
The wine has a colour of medium depth with subtle purple tinges. The aromas show typical Cabernet spice underpinned with dark rich ripe plum fruit characters from the Merlot component. The palate is of medium weight with firm tannin structure. Hints of fennel, coconut and seductive tobacco complement the primary grape flavours.

Sandalford Protege Cabernet Merlot 2004
|
|
The 2004 vintage was marked by dry, warm to hot conditions throughout the southwest of Western Australia (WA). These conditions lead to disease-free grapes with ripe fruit flavours and moderate acidity levels.
In relative terms the Protégé wines are positioned between the Sandalford Premium (Margaret River) range and the entry-level Element (WA) range.
